Consumer Description
BRAND NEW 2010 FORD ESCAPE EXHIBITS HARSH, UNILATERAL "CLUNK" ON PASSENGER SIDE WHILE TRAVELING OVER BUMPS AND DIPS AS IF REBOUND ACTION OF SHOCK IS FAILING. THIS CLUNK OCCURS AT POSTED SPEED LIMITS AND MAY CAUSE A LOSS OF CONTROL AT HIGHER SPEEDS OR MORE SEVERE BUMPS OR POTHOLES. THE LOCAL FORD DEALER TEST DROVE WITH ME AND THEY WERE INITIALLY ALARMED, BUT AFTER DRIVING OTHER ESCAPES, THE SAME CLUNK OCCURS AND I WAS TOLD THIS IS A NORMAL OPERATING CHARACTERISTIC. THIS IS MY 2ND ESCAPE AND MY 2006 DOES NOT EXHIBIT THIS CLUNK, NOR DO ANY OTHER OF MY VEHICLES.
